Scheler Name Meaning

German: from an agent derivative of Middle High German scheln ‘to peel’ probably an occupational name for someone who peeled bark from trees for use in the tanning process.

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Scheler family from?

You can see how Scheler families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Scheler family name was found in the USA, the UK, Canada, and Scotland between 1840 and 1920. The most Scheler families were found in USA in 1920. In 1891 there were 6 Scheler families living in Yorkshire. This was about 55% of all the recorded Scheler's in United Kingdom. Yorkshire had the highest population of Scheler families in 1891.

What did your Scheler 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Housewife were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Scheler. 37% of Scheler men worked as a Laborer and 29% of Scheler women worked as a Housewife. Some less common occupations for Americans named Scheler were Mechanic and Housekeeper. .
